A preamp works on RECEIVED signals. It won't do a thing for
TRANSMITTED signals. The worse thing that could happen is
you could pop the keying transistor that switches the preamp
out of line when you transmit. (or the detection diode the
drives the keying transistor) You would want to put that
before any amplifier. Expect any preamp to amplify the noise
that you don't want as much as the signals you do want. Some
are so broadbanded that you will overload your receiver and
hear things that aren't there. You could also use it for your
shortwave and VHF-LO on your scanner. If you're close to any
transmitters, it may be unusable to you.

On sideband, unless there is a delay on the relay, it will chatter.
